- Family members of the Uvalde shooting victims demanded action from the Texas Department of Public Safety, including the resignation of Col. Steven McCraw.
Texas officials were criticized for their response to the shooting, after nearly 400 officers from multiple agencies waited outside classrooms before confronting the shooter.
